#403554 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#403554 is composed of 25.1% red, 20.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.8% cyan, 36.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 261.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.6% and a lightness of 26.9%. #403554 color hex could be obtained by blending #806aa8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#403554

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09070c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#403554

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434049 is the less saturated color, while #310089 is the most saturated one.
